We can use process of elimination to determine the name of the monster Beowulf fought.
Chaucer is the last name of the author of <em>The Canterbury Tales</em>. Chaunticleer is also the name of a character in that poem.
William the Conqueror is the name of a historical king that invaded England from France.
That just leaves Grendel, the name the monster that Beowulf fights in Hrothgar's kingdom.
